About the Book

The history of Christianity flows through time altered by individuals like a stream encountering rocks in its path. Small stones might only make a ripple. Boulders may literally alter the course of the stream. This book takes a look at the flow of Christian history by examining the lives of twenty-two men and women and how they impacted Christianity over the last two thousand years.


About the Author

Rob Wingerter is founder and president of Mahseh Ministries Inc., which has operated a Christian retreat center in northern Indiana since 2006. Rob is a CPA and attorney as well as a graduate of Covenant Theological Seminary. Rob was a partner at Ernst & Young LLP for twenty-five years before retiring in 2012. Rob’s previous book is Regaining Your Spiritual Poise, which explores the need for spiritual retreat in the life of Christians.
